專利名稱:手電筒燈光的控制方法
技術(shù)領(lǐng)域:
本發(fā)明涉及照明領(lǐng)域,具體講是一種手電筒燈光的控制方法。
背景技術(shù):
手電筒是一種普通的照明裝置, 一般用在沒有其他照明設(shè)備或者不方便使用照明電源的 場所,廣泛應(yīng)用于探險、旅游、礦山和家庭等場所,目前,現(xiàn)有技術(shù)的手電筒的控制方法, 一般只能控制一個光源,并且只有開與關(guān)這種簡單的功能,這種手電筒燈光的控制方法有以 下缺點第一,無法控制手電筒自動關(guān)閉,浪費電量;第二,只能控制一個光源,功能單一, 采用這種控制方法的手電筒無法作為信號燈使用,不能提供給使用者有效的幫助。
發(fā)明內(nèi)容
本發(fā)明要解決的技術(shù)問題是,克服現(xiàn)有的技術(shù)缺陷,提供一種能夠控制兩個光源,功能 較多,并且又省電的一種手電筒燈光的控制方法。
本發(fā)明提供的一種手電筒燈光的控制方法,它有以下順序的五個步驟
(1) :讀取手電筒開關(guān)的按鍵信息,如果有按鍵的動作,則手電筒跳到第一個檔位運行, 即前燈亮,如果在給定時間t之內(nèi)再次接受到按鍵的信息,則跳到步驟(2),如果在給定時 間t之內(nèi),沒有其他控制信息,則跳到步驟(5);
(2) :手電筒跳到第二個檔位運行,即前燈和后燈一起亮,如果給定時間t之內(nèi)再次接 收到按鍵的信息,則跳到步驟(3),如果在給定時間t之內(nèi),沒有其他控制信息,則跳到步 驟(5);
(3) :手電筒跳到第三個檔位運行,即前燈關(guān)閉、后燈亮,如果給定時間之內(nèi)再次接收 到按鍵的信息,則跳到步驟(4),如果在給定時間t之內(nèi),沒有其他控制信息,則跳到步驟
(5);
(4) :手電筒跳到第四個檔位運行,即前燈滅、后燈閃亮,如果給定時間t之內(nèi)再次接 收到按鍵的信息,則跳到步驟(5),如果在給定時間t之內(nèi),沒有其他控制信息,則跳到步 驟(5);
(5) :手電筒跳到第五個檔位運行,前燈和后燈一起關(guān)閉,整個手電筒關(guān)閉。所述的時間t為手電筒設(shè)置的延時關(guān)閉的時間,可自行設(shè)定。 本發(fā)明與現(xiàn)有技術(shù)相比,具有以下優(yōu)點第一,手電筒光源的控制都有延時關(guān)閉的設(shè)置, 當使用者忘記關(guān)閉手電筒時,經(jīng)過設(shè)定的時間t之后,手電筒可自行關(guān)閉,節(jié)約電能,第二, 本控制方法可控制兩個光源,當前燈和后燈同時亮的時候,可對前方照明,并同時為后方的 人提供信號,當在使用者遭遇危險時,可控制手電筒后燈閃亮,發(fā)出求救信號,方便使用者。
圖1是本發(fā)明手電筒燈光的控制方法的系統(tǒng)流程圖2是本發(fā)明手電筒燈光的控制方法具體實例中控制板的電路原理圖。
具體實施例方式
下面結(jié)合圖l、圖2對本發(fā)明作進一步詳細的說明
如圖所示,圖1為本發(fā)明手電筒燈光的控制方法的系統(tǒng)流程圖,本控制方法可在單片機 中使用,在系統(tǒng)開始時,手電筒控制板中的單片機讀取手電筒按鍵開關(guān)是否動作,如果有, 則手電筒跳到第一個檔位運行,即前燈開啟,如果沒有動作,則跳到上一步,手電筒不做任 何動作,從手電筒在第一個檔位運行時,t時間之內(nèi)單片機繼續(xù)監(jiān)測按鍵開關(guān)是否動作,如果 有,則手電筒跳到第二個檔位運行,即前燈和后燈一起開啟,如果沒有,則手電筒在t時間 之后自動跳到第五個檔位,即前燈和后燈一起關(guān)閉,手電筒關(guān)閉;從手電筒在第二個檔位運 行時,在t時間之內(nèi)單片機繼續(xù)監(jiān)測按鍵開關(guān)是否動作,如果有,則手電筒跳到第三個檔位 運行,即前燈關(guān)閉、后燈開啟,如果沒有,則手電筒在t時間之后自動跳到第五個檔位;從 手電筒在第三個檔位運行時,在t時間之內(nèi)單片機繼續(xù)監(jiān)測按鍵開關(guān)是否動作,如果有,則 手電筒跳到第四個檔位運行,即前燈關(guān)閉、后燈閃亮,如果沒有,則手電筒在t時間之后自 動跳到第五個檔位;從手電筒在第四個檔位運行時,在t時間之內(nèi)單片機繼續(xù)監(jiān)測按鍵開關(guān)
是否動作,如果有,則手電筒跳到第五個檔位運行,如果沒有,則手電筒在t時間之后自動 跳到第五個檔位。所述的時間t為一給定的延時關(guān)閉的時間,可自行設(shè)定。
圖2為本發(fā)明手電筒燈光的控制方法的一個具體實例控制板的電路原理圖,如圖所示, 此控制板包括兩個LED燈源,前燈LED1和后燈LED2, 一個單片機,其型號為TB630A, 一個二極管D1,兩個電容C1、 C2,兩個開關(guān)一個按鍵開關(guān)Sl, 一個水開關(guān)S2,三個三極 管Tl、 T2、 T3,四個電阻Rl、 R2、 R3、 R4,本控制電路中所用電源為直流電源,二極管 Dl的負極接電源的負極,正極接單片機TB630A的8端口,電容Cl的一端接電源的正極, 另一端接電源的負極,單片機TB630A的1、 4端口接電源的正極,按鍵開關(guān)S1的一段接單片機TB630A的5端口 ,另一端接三極管Tl的發(fā)射極,三極管Tl的集電極接單片機TB630A 的3端口,基極接電阻R1和R2的公共端,電阻R1—端接按鍵開關(guān)S1—端接電阻R2,電 阻R2的另一端接水開關(guān)S2,水開關(guān)S2的另一端接電源的正極,電阻R3 —端接單片機TB630A 的6端口,另一端接三極管T2的基極,三極管T2的集電極接后燈LED2的正極,發(fā)射極接 電源的正極,電阻R4的一端接接單片機TB630A的7端口 ,另一端接另一端接三極管T3的 基極,三極管T3的集電極接前燈LED1的正極,發(fā)射極接電源的正極。在這個控制電路中, 單片機TB630A可接受到按鍵開關(guān)Sl、 S2的開關(guān)信號,然后控制電路中的前燈LED1和后燈 LED2的開啟和關(guān)閉。
權(quán)利要求
1,一種手電筒燈光的控制方法,它有以下順序的五個步驟(1)讀取手電筒開關(guān)的按鍵信息,如果有按鍵的動作,則手電筒跳到第一個檔位運行,即前燈亮,如果在給定時間t之內(nèi)再次接受到按鍵的信息,則跳到步驟(2),如果在給定時間t之內(nèi),沒有其他控制信息,則跳到步驟(5);(2)手電筒跳到第二個檔位運行,即前燈和后燈一起亮,如果給定時間t之內(nèi)再次接收到按鍵的信息,則跳到步驟(3),如果在給定時間t之內(nèi),沒有其他控制信息,則跳到步驟(5);(3)手電筒跳到第三個檔位運行,即前燈關(guān)閉、后燈亮,如果給定時間之內(nèi)再次接收到按鍵的信息,則跳到步驟(4),如果在給定時間t之內(nèi),沒有其他控制信息,則跳到步驟(5);(4)手電筒跳到第四個檔位運行,即前燈滅、后燈閃亮,如果給定時間t之內(nèi)再次接收到按鍵的信息,則跳到步驟(5),如果在給定時間t之內(nèi),沒有其他控制信息,則跳到步驟(5);(5)手電筒跳到第五個檔位運行,即前燈和后燈一起關(guān)閉,整個手電筒關(guān)閉。
全文摘要
本發(fā)明涉及一種手電筒燈光的控制方法,它可以控制手電筒的兩個光源在不同的五個檔位之間運行,所述五個檔位之間的轉(zhuǎn)換是通過讀取手電筒按鍵開關(guān)的開關(guān)信息,從而做出檔位轉(zhuǎn)換的控制。這種手電筒燈光的控制方法,當使用者忘記關(guān)閉手電筒時,可控制手電筒自行關(guān)閉,節(jié)約電能;并且本控制方法可控制兩個光源,當前燈和后燈同時亮的時候,可對前方照明,并同時為后方的人提供信號,當在使用者遭遇危險時,可控制手電筒后燈閃亮,發(fā)出求救信號,方便使用者。
文檔編號H05B37/02GK101600282SQ20091010046
公開日2009年12月9日 申請日期2009年6月30日 優(yōu)先權(quán)日2009年6月30日
發(fā)明者堅 劉 申請人:堅 劉